Description

An extended four bedroom character family home offered for sale with no onward chain situated with easy reach of local schools, shops and playing fields as well as Farnborough North and Main Stations (Waterloo 37 mins). Accommodation comprises entrance porch, hall, living room, playroom/study, kitchen/dining room, family room, utility room, shower room, four bedrooms, bathroom. Features to note include log burning stove, modern open plan kitchen/dining room, driveway parking for three vehicles, 140ft rear garden with views of Farnborough Abbey and an office/studio with mains electric. Energy Efficiency Rating 'D'
